Out-of-favour midfielder expected to depart club
Sky Sports understands Swansea midfielder Scott Donnelly is expected to leave the Liberty Stadium this summer.
Donnelly has made just a single league appearance for the Swans since joining from Aldershot two years ago, as an 81st minute substitute during a 3-0 victory over Crystal Palace in 2010.
He spent the second half of the 2010-11 campaign and the whole of last season on loan at Wycombe Wanderers, who have been relegated to League Two.
It is thought the 24-year-old feels it is time to move on from the Welsh club, with new manager Michael Laudrup expected to bring in some fresh signings this summer.
A number of clubs are believed to be monitoring Donnelly's situation.
